Transaction 1106aa37a8fd82d31c7244f19a432bbaf7ab6e551841f9e7f333009d3255c03a

36 Input
2 Outputs
  • 1106aa37a8fd82d31c7244f19a432bbaf7ab6e551841f9e7f333009d3255c03a:0
  • value  161463792
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r
  • 1106aa37a8fd82d31c7244f19a432bbaf7ab6e551841f9e7f333009d3255c03a:1
  • value  99299508
    address  363wxigXbsw1uinZVrYQZufatyJ5Mt9zd4